Suggested Bibliography/Works Cited Format

FOR A BOOK:

Author’s last name, first name. Title of book. Place of publication: Publisher, copyright year.

Fixx, James F. The Complete Book of Running. New York: Random, 1977.

FOR A BOOK WITH TWO AUTHORS:

Author’s last name, first name and 2nd author’s first name, last name. Title of book. Place of publication: Publisher, copyright year.

Balanchine, George, and Francis Mason. 101 Stories of the Great Ballets.

New York: Doubleday, 1975.

FOR AN ENCYCLOPEDIA ARTICLE WITHOUT AN AUTHOR:

"Title of article." Name of encyclopedia. Copyright year. Volume number, page(s).

"Golden Retriever." World Book Encyclopedia. 2003. Volume 8, p.255.

FOR AN ENCYCLOPEDIA ARTICLE WITH AN AUTHOR:

Article author’s last name, first name. "Title of article." Name of encyclopedia. Copyright year. Volume number, page(s).

Clark, William W. "Gothic Art." World Book Encyclopedia. 2004.

Volume 8, pp. 277-278.

FOR A MAGAZINE OR NEWSPAPER ARTICLE:

"Title or headline of article." Name of magazine or newspaper. Date of magazine or newspaper, page(s).

“The Power of Writing.” National Geographic. Aug. 1999: pp. 110-132.

FOR A MAGAZINE/NEWSPAPER WITH AUTHOR.

Article author’s last name, first name. "Title or headline of article." Name of magazine or newspaper. Date of magazine or newspaper, page(s).

Cannon, Angie and David L. Marcus. “The Boy Under the Desk.” U. S. News and World

Report. 26 July 1999: pp. 22-28.

FOR AN INTERNET ADDRESS:

Author’s last name, first name (if given). "Title of item." Publisher. Date of article. date of access..

Rockmore, Anne. “Five Worst Teen Jobs.” National Consumers League. 30 June 1997.

Now combine your citations to make a completed bibliography. It will look something like this:

General rules:

1)alphabetize by the first word of the entry

2) Begin first line of citation at the left margin.

3) Tab five spaces for 2nd line and all those following.

4) Double space between lines and entries.
